    • A probe pin comprises a coil spring (3), a first plunger (1) including a major portion (11), a first elastic extension (12) and a second elastic extension (13), the first and the second elastic extensions (12, 13) extending from the major portion (11) in the same direction and a second plunger (2) forcedly inserted between the first and the second elastic extensions (12, 13). The first and the second plungers (1, 2) have electric conductivity, and the first and the second plungers (1, 2) are inserted from one and the other ends of the coil spring (3), respectively, so that the first and the second elastic extensions (12, 13) of the first plunger (1) hold the second plunger (2) with the first elastic extension (12) making a forced contact with a surface of the second plunger (2) to form thereat an electric connection between the first and the second plungers (1, 2).

    • Provided are a contactor and a probe using the same, the contactor being free of occurrence of processing strain and having a long life and low production cost even when it is a narrow and long contactor. To this end, a bellows body (20), a fixed portion (30) connected to one end (21) of the bellows body (20) and a movable portion (40) connected to the other end (22) of the bellows body (20) are integrally molded by electroforming. The movable portion (40) is depressed to compress the bellows body (20), thereby bringing adjacent arc portions (24, 24) of the bellows body (20) into contact with each other to cause a short circuit.

    • In a probe pin (1) including a coil spring (30), and first and second plungers (10, 20), when the first and second plungers are respectively inserted from both ends of the coil spring (30) toward an inside thereof, the first and second plungers are disposed in a reciprocable manner along an axis center of the coil spring while slide contact surfaces thereof (17, 27) are in slide contact with each other, and the first and second plungers are formed so that the coil spring can be held between a body portion (11) of the first plunger (10) and a body portion (21) of the second plunger (20). The first and second plungers are formed so that the first and second plungers are close to each other and a contact area where the slide contact surface (17) of the first plunger (10) is in contact with the slide contact surface (27) of the second plunger (20) is tilted with respect to the axis center.

    • Provided is a contactor having desired conductivity while ensuring a predetermined displacement amount. To this end, the contactor has: a bellows body (20); a fixed portion (30) connected to one end (21) of the bellows body (20); and a movable portion (40) connected to the other end (22) of the bellows body (20) and having a movable touch piece (42) that extends along the bellows body (20) from at least one side edge of the movable portion (40). The movable portion (40) is depressed to compress the bellows body (20) and bring a movable contact point (43), located at a free end of the movable touch piece (42), into contact with the fixed portion (30).
